What is meant by self-discipline?
It refers to a person's capacity to act upon what needs to be done, at the appropriate time, regardless of their inclination. Additionally, it denotes one's ability to distance oneself from transient pleasures and comforts, aiming instead for long-term achievements and aspirations.
This greatly contributes to an individual's sense of self-satisfaction and provides them with a solid foundation for achieving further goals. Self-discipline can also be described as the ability to regulate one's emotions, impulses, feelings, desires, and actions across all circumstances and events.
Moreover, it stands as one of the most crucial tools for personal development, existing within every individual, and serving as a significant facilitator for pursuing numerous positive endeavors while steering clear of negativity.
Ways To Cultivate Self-Discipline
There are numerous tips for developing self-discipline. Allow us, dear reader, to highlight several of these approaches:
1. Consistently Maintaining Clear Thinking
Maintaining clear thinking is paramount in fostering self-discipline. When encountering any challenges in life, engage in meditation exercises to attain complete relaxation. Subsequently, write down the issue on a separate sheet of paper, followed by conducting a mental inquiry session where you thoroughly explore all facets of the problem and seek suitable solutions.

4. Avoid Time-Wasting, Use Time Effectively
Effective time management directly impacts success in all your endeavors. Hence, dear reader, strive to embody the principle, "Every minute devoted to planning saves ten minutes in execution." To achieve this, craft a daily task list and prioritize your tasks accordingly, ultimately saving you precious time.

8. Regularly Saving Money And Investing
Financial independence is vital for achieving success. If you're in debt, prioritize paying off those debts promptly. Then, make a habit of saving money consistently. Initially, you can set aside a specific percentage of your income, gradually increasing it each month. Once you've accumulated the desired amount, consider investing it in a project that aligns with your financial goals and the amount you've saved.

11. Replacing Outdated Habits That Serve No Purpose
In your quest for self-discipline, you'll likely want to replace existing negative habits. To achieve this, you must fill the void left by abandoning these detrimental behaviors. This can be accomplished by creating a list of positive activities to engage in during your newfound free time.

What Are The Benefits Of Self-Discipline?
A person with self-discipline enjoys many advantages, including:
1. Enjoy better health
A disciplined individual can adhere to a highly nutritious diet, maintain healthy habits, and exercise regularly, resulting in a fit and healthy body.
2. Enjoying profound personal happiness
A disciplined individual exudes a heightened sense of responsibility, understanding both their rights and obligations. This adeptness steers them clear of conflicts with colleagues and those around them, leading to a more stable life.
3. Attaining significant accomplishments
A self-disciplined individual excels at setting precise goals, crafting plans, and executing strategies that guarantee success, enabling them to achieve their desired objectives within an impressive timeframe.
4. Life satisfaction
Those with self-discipline tend to be content with their lives, experiencing lower rates of depression or other mental health issues.
